加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

SQLServer 查询当前服务器有多少连接请求的语句

发布时间:2020-12-12 09:43:23 所属栏目:MsSql教程 来源:网络整理
导读:SQL Server本身提供了这么一个DMV来返回这些信息,它就是sys.dm_exec_sessions 。 比如在我的机器上做一下查询: div class="codetitle" a style="CURSOR: pointer" data="51064" class="copybut" id="copybut51064" onclick="doCopy('code51064')" 代码如下

SQL Server本身提供了这么一个DMV来返回这些信息,它就是sys.dm_exec_sessions 。
比如在我的机器上做一下查询:
<div class="codetitle"><a style="CURSOR: pointer" data="51064" class="copybut" id="copybut51064" onclick="doCopy('code51064')"> 代码如下:<div class="codebody" id="code51064">
SELECT * FROM sys.dm_exec_sessions WHERE host_name IS NOT NULL
  
如图:

我们也可以根据登录名来分组:
代码如下:SELECT login_name,COUNT(session_id) AS session_count
FROM sys.dm_exec_sessions
GROUP BY login_name;

查询结果如图:

对于这张表的详细字段说明,请参考MSDNhttp://msdn.microsoft.com/en-us/library/ms176013.aspx

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读